The Project “Decent Life for Disabled Persons”

The project “Decent Life for Disabled Persons” is one of the most important Projects being arranged by our Foundation. We started the Project in 2008 and continued its implementation during this year – that allowed thousands of disabled people living all over the Republic to feel free in their movement.
In 2010 17 specially equipped “invataxi” vehicles were acquired and delivered to Associations of Disabled Persons existing in seven cities of Kazakhstan. Another six vehicles are currently re-equipped at the Manufacturing Works in Germany, and thereafter they will be also distributed among Associations of Disabled Persons. Thus, the total number of vehicles under the Project is 41 units, and in 12 regions people are already using them.

Successful implementation of the Project has allowed this year to conduct, using our specially equipped vehicles, a large-scale 2-month-campaign for organizing tourist trips for disabled persons. Here in Almaty we have outlined the “invataxi” routes to take the disabled people around the city to show them (perhaps for the first time in their life) places of interest, monuments and architectural buildings. .

Also, in order to exchange experience, the “Saby” Charitable Foundation has arranged financing the visit of the Chairman of the Union of Disabled Persons’ Organizations of Kazakhstan to Japan, where he learned the principles of social work of their Public Associations.

Educational Project

Education project, being of special importance for “Saby”, was updated this year with new sub-stages: mainly for successful adaptation process of all graduates from the sponsored children’s social institutions, for these purposes we have arranged a 7 – month trainings in the field of psychological correction of a personality by a highly-professional clinical psychologist, including a 6-year training course for passing the Unified National Testing at the Municipal Tutorial Center. Total we have 70 children under the Project.

Also we have continued our traditional two-stage computer-based specialized testing for the purpose to determine the children’s abilities to one or another profession. This year we had more than 100 students so tested.
Besides, 36 graduates of the 8th orphan homes and boarding schools of 4 regions of Kazakhstan have got financial support for payment of education in vocational and higher educational institutions.

Sports Project

The Sports Project under which the “Saby” Charitable Foundation is engaged in building sports and playgrounds in the Children’s Social Institutions, was completed with additional three objects this year.
A large playground was presented by Saby to the patients of “Shymbulak” Children’s Tuberculosis Sanatorium: now those kids, being treated for many months, have a possibility to improve their health outdoors using slides, swings, carousels, horizontal bars and rings.

The same playground was presented to junior-foster children of boarding school in Kaskelen, and the older children of this institution received a multi-sports ground for playing football, volleyball, basketball; and in winter children may skate, do figure-skating and play hockey.

It should be noted that our Foundation is not only engaged in Building Projects, we really care about the future of sports facilities we built and their proper use within the Project. For this purpose we have organized classes for foster children with highly qualified coaches inside these facilities. To the date, unfortunately, only the children of the two orphan homes – Almaty Orphan Home No. 2 and the Regional Orphan Home No. 1 – have a possibility to have classes with professionals. Later, when we have positive results we will continue this Project within other institutions.

Medical Project

Medical Project initiated by the Foundation is also under its great progress.
“Saby” continued its patronage over the neuro – stroke unit INSO-2 of the Almaty Clinical Hospital No 7. In addition to 12 nurses who took a computer literacy course last year we have another 7 ones. Thus, 19 medical technicians also improved their professional skills thanks to the efforts of the Foundation.

In addition, we have acquired special foam material used in manufacturing of mattress for preventing pressures sores for stroke patients.
The most important event this year was installation of the equipment and facilities on the basis of INSO-2 class for training stroke patients – the only one here in Almaty and in Kazakhstan, the undeniable importance of which was appreciated both by the Leaders of the Almaty Health Department and their colleagues from the CIS countries.

Another Medical Object of the Foundation was the Baby House in Karakastek village, Almaty Oblast. Therapeutic equipment for physiotherapist’s office was purchased for small foster children.

Although the targeted assistance is not the main activity of our Foundation, but every year we have to face with urgent cases, when it is impossible not to give your helping hand to a person being in trouble. In this situation we mean a pretty young girl Olga by name with the “generalized form of myasthenia”. The given disease is a rare one and is not yet treated here in Kazakhstan, and the “Saby” Charitable Foundation provided Olga with a charity support in the form of financing of her surgery and rehabilitation period there in the Medical Institute in Moscow.

Building Activity

Work on the construction and reconstruction of social objects was proceeeded with renovation of dining complex in the Kazakh school – boarding-school after Nusipbaeva, where a hall for meal and a room for narrow celebrations decorated with art paintings, turned into a fairyland of Little Prince.
Also, in order to repair the kindergarten and dining complex in the specialized complex “Januya”, funds have been allocated for the purchase of necessary materials.

But undoubtedly, the most significant event this year was the decision to build a new modern building for children’s home in Kyzylorda. Currently, 60 baby-orphans of this institution are living in an old damaged frame-reed building. Severe climatic conditions, zone of ecological disaster of the Aral Sea, constant shortage of drinking water and as a result – a low level of life and health of local people, especially children, encourages our Foundation to pay special attention to this region. To date, schematic design of structures has been already prepared, detailed design and construction documents are next in turn. Commencement of construction works is scheduled for March next year.

“Save the Children’s Life” SМS-action

This year the “Saby” Charitable Foundation continued its cooperation with the Mercy Volunteer Society including Beeline, K-Mobile, and K-Cell in arrangement of the “Save the Children’s Life” SМS-action, that began four years ago. During that time we have received numerous contributions from Kazakhstani people totaled to more than 1.5 million US dollars, as a result we had about 300 Kazakhstani children from all regions of the Republic who have been successfully operated outside the Republic of Kazakhstan.

Three cities of Kazakhstan have received 6 “Invataxi” vehicles

By | Decent life for Disabled Persons

Three cities of Kazakhstan have received 6 “Invataxi” vehicles 6 new specially equipped vehicles acquired for disabled persons living in three cities of Kazakhstan were presented by the state holiday – the Independence Day of Kazakhstan. Now these cars are running in Kokshetau, Shymkent and Temirtau – two cars in each city: Volkswagen Caddy and Volkswagen Transporter, and help disabled persons move faster, in comfortable conditions and free of charge.

This event has become a reason for a visit of chairmen of municipal associations of disabled persons to the “Saby” Charitable Foundation, where they received vehicles and all accompanying documents. All guests spoke very friendly about the work of the Foundation under the project “Decent Life for Disabled Persons” and noted its importance for disabled persons.

The project “Decent Life for Disabled Persons” was started in spring 2008 and now it is one of the most important projects of the “Saby” Foundation. The final objective of the project is to organize specialized car fleets of “Invataxi” service in all cities of Kazakhstan.

Tutors are going to help children study better

By | news

Tutors are going to help children study better At the beginning of this month the “Saby” Charitable Foundation started a 6-months programme of lessons for senior high school students of orphanages within the framework of its Educational Project. The lessons are held in the tutorial center so that pupils could improve their knowledge in basic subjects and increase their results when passing the unified national testing.

Our Foundation has made a decision to support children in forming their skills in hard work with training material and reinforcement of learning received at school. Intensive study of subjects and individual assistance rendered by specialists will help children in choosing their future professions. Besides, “excellent” marks will allow many children to get further financial support from the “Saby” Foundation for payment of education in vocational and higher educational institutions.

Thus, using the whole series of stages of work with future leavers of child social institutions including the work with a psychologist for psychological correction of children during the whole school year, organization of computer-based specialized testing with the aim to determine their abilities to one or another profession, semi-annual tutorial lessons as well as further payment for education in colleges and higher educational institutions, we are preparing gradually the children for independent living through their socialization and professional establishing.
